单片机期末考试试题_第1页
单片机期末考试试题_第2页
单片机期末考试试题_第3页
单片机期末考试试题_第4页
单片机期末考试试题_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

考试科目:单片机原理及应用考试时间:120分钟满分:100分适用专业:自动化、电子信息工程、物联网工程等---一、选择题(每题2分,共20分)1.下列关于单片机的描述,错误的是()A.单片机是将CPU、存储器、I/O接口等集成在一块芯片上的微型计算机B.单片机具有体积小、功耗低、性价比高的特点C.单片机内部只包含中央处理器(CPU)和存储器,不包含输入输出接口D.单片机广泛应用于智能仪器仪表、工业控制、消费电子等领域2.MCS-51系列单片机的程序计数器PC是一个()位的寄存器,其作用是()。A.8,存放当前正在执行的指令B.16,存放当前正在执行的指令的地址C.8,存放将要执行的下一条指令的地址D.16,存放将要执行的下一条指令的地址3.在MCS-51单片机中,若晶振频率为12MHz,则一个机器周期为()。A.1msB.1µsC.2µsD.6µs4.MCS-51单片机的内部数据存储器(RAM)可分为几个区域?其中可位寻址区的地址范围是()。A.2个区域,00H~7FHB.3个区域,20H~2FHC.3个区域,00H~1FHD.4个区域,80H~FFH5.以下关于MCS-51单片机中断系统的说法,正确的是()。A.MCS-51单片机有3个中断源B.中断服务程序的入口地址是固定的C.同级中断不能嵌套D.外部中断只能通过电平触发方式请求中断6.MCS-51单片机的定时器/计数器T0有几种工作模式?当需要产生一个较精确的1ms定时,且希望尽可能少占用CPU时间时,应选择哪种工作模式并采用何种方式实现?()A.2种,模式0,查询方式B.4种,模式2,中断方式C.3种,模式1,中断方式D.4种,模式3,查询方式7.串行通信中,以下哪种通信方式可以实现全双工通信?()A.单工B.半双工C.全双工D.以上都可以8.MCS-51单片机的串行口工作在方式1时,其波特率()。A.固定为fosc/12B.固定为fosc/32C.固定为fosc/64D.由定时器T1的溢出率决定9.在MCS-51汇编语言程序中,指令“MOVA,#45H”的源操作数的寻址方式是()。A.立即寻址B.直接寻址C.寄存器寻址D.寄存器间接寻址10.以下哪种不是单片机系统中常用的抗干扰措施?()A.硬件滤波B.软件陷阱C.提高时钟频率D.看门狗定时器---二、填空题(每空1分,共20分)1.MCS-51系列单片机的典型芯片8051内部包含______KB的程序存储器(ROM)和______B的数据存储器(RAM)。2.单片机的复位电路通常有______复位和______复位两种方式。当复位信号有效时,PC的值为______H,SP的值为______H,P0~P3口的值为______H。3.MCS-51单片机的P0口作为通用I/O口使用时,需要外接______电阻;而P1、P2、P3口内部已集成有______电阻,可以直接作为通用I/O口使用。4.中断响应的全过程包括:中断请求、______、______、______和中断返回。5.MCS-51单片机的定时器/计数器有______和______两种工作模式,当设置为计数模式时,计数脉冲来自于______。6.串行通信的两个重要指标是______和______。7.MCS-51单片机有______个特殊功能寄存器(SFR),它们离散地分布在______H至______H的地址空间中,且只有地址能被______整除的SFR才具有位寻址能力。8.若要禁止MCS-51单片机的所有中断,应将中断允许寄存器IE中的______位清零。9.在汇编语言中,______伪指令用于定义程序或数据的起始地址,______伪指令用于结束汇编。---三、简答题(每题5分,共30分)1.简述MCS-51单片机的时钟电路和机器周期的概念。若单片机采用6MHz的晶振,其机器周期是多少?2.什么是单片机的堆栈?堆栈有何作用?在MCS-51单片机中,堆栈指针SP的初始值是多少?如何改变堆栈的位置?3.比较MCS-51单片机四个并行I/O口(P0~P3)在结构和功能上的异同点。4.简述MCS-51单片机外部中断0(INT0)从低电平触发方式改为边沿触发方式的配置步骤。5.定时器/计数器T0工作在模式2(8位自动重装初值模式)有何特点?适用于什么场合?6.什么是A/D转换?在单片机应用系统中,常用的A/D转换器有哪些主要性能指标?---四、分析与设计题(共30分)1.(10分)已知MCS-51单片机的晶振频率为12MHz,请利用定时器T0的模式1(16位定时器模式)编写一段延时子程序,要求延时时间为10ms。假设系统不使用中断,采用查询方式实现。(需写出定时器初值计算过程及完整的汇编语言子程序)2.(10分)如图所示(注:此处实际考试应有图,现为文字描述:P1.0口接一个LED发光二极管的阴极,二极管阳极通过一个限流电阻接+5V电源),要求利用MCS-51单片机的P1.0口控制一个LED发光二极管,实现LED以大约1秒的周期闪烁(即亮500ms,灭500ms)。请完成以下任务:(1)画出该简单应用系统的硬件连接示意图(可用文字描述代替)。(2)若采用定时器T1中断方式实现延时,请编写完整的汇编语言主程序和中断服务程序。(晶振频率为12MHz,可合理利用第1题的延时子程序或重新设计)3.(10分)简述一个基于MCS-51单片机的简单温度采集与显示系统的组成部分及工作原理。至少应包括传感器选择、信号调理、A/D转换、单片机处理和显示输出等环节。---考生注意事项:1.请用黑色或蓝色水笔在答题卡指定位置作答,在本试卷上作答无效。2.保持卷面整洁,字迹清晰。3.答案应写出必要的

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论